The CMOS technology for the hardware modems has been out there for years, and has had time to mature. Look at a hardware modem and you will see chips from Intel, Texas instruments and others.<BR>The dedicated hardware solution will always be more powerful than any software emulation of it, because software must "steal" system resources. <P>A hardware modem brings it's own.<P>edit:typo<P>[This message has been edited by spoof (edited December 10, 1999).]
